RABIES - AN INFECTIOUS DISEASE WITH A FATAL OUTCOME (CLINICAL CASE)

Abstract

Actuality. Rabies is an acute, progressive, incurable infectious disease accompanied by viral encephalitis. The main reservoirs of the virus in wild nature are two genera of mammals, but the greatest danger worldwide is rabid dogs. Today, rabies is registered in 150 countries and territories of the world, on all continents except Antarctica. Aim. To assess the current situation regarding rabies in Ukraine in general and in the Vinnytsia region in particular, we collected information on the current state of rabies cases and analyzed the medical record of a patient hospitalized with this disease. Results. The clinical case described by us is intended to draw attention to the problem of the rabies spreading, to raise awareness of the consequences of this disease and ways of its prevention, since the problem is not only medical, but also nationwide. Conclusions. It is necessary to review the established restrictions and bans on hunting both throughout the territory of Ukraine in general and in the Vinnytsia region in particular. It is worth paying more attention to informing the population with the help of mass media and preventive work of doctors. It is advisable to take measures to strengthen control over vaccination of domestic animals. It is extremely important to ensure that sufficient amounts of vaccine and rabies immunoglobulin are available. The information provided will be useful to infectious disease doctors, epidemiologists, traumatologists, family doctors, and students of medical universities and colleges.
